Output b8403b7647204ef0fbf597a172f7d9cfa96b3eb6e73ac2c5849c07dce083f3b4:15

value
35707642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e31496cb2a79d7cff597b1d4a2bf674df36b082 OP_EQUAL
address
MDa1AqBmqLhKUp6GgdumfotCyHkPKnMVf1
transaction
b8403b7647204ef0fbf597a172f7d9cfa96b3eb6e73ac2c5849c07dce083f3b4
spent
true